Transaction 815ec54fb1e838a166ec03391e3e2d765563b2f8de74fc469ee462bef1733c3a

1 Input
2 Outputs
  • 815ec54fb1e838a166ec03391e3e2d765563b2f8de74fc469ee462bef1733c3a:0
  • value  14564028
    address  1DMp113jzGekhLHsUDHNWfsJWRRuy7cjUo
  • 815ec54fb1e838a166ec03391e3e2d765563b2f8de74fc469ee462bef1733c3a:1
  • value  4865000
    address  19DJVqFgkJ9dTFeanzJRi2HsssiETQmApw